Spoiler-Safe Classic Reading Companion
Build a reading companion for dense classic novels that helps readers track characters, relationships, and key context without spoilers. The strongest wedge is helping people finish books they repeatedly abandon because the opening is confusing or name-heavy.
Why this matters
You want to finally read a famous novel that everyone says is rewarding, but the first hundred pages feel like work. Too many similar names, shifting social scenes, and unfamiliar context make you lose the thread before the plot grips you. You start over more than once, take your own notes, or open outside references just to remember who each person is. Those workarounds break immersion and can accidentally reveal later events. What you need is a companion that stays exactly where you are in the book, reminds you who matters, and helps you continue without turning reading into homework.

Why This Might Fail
Self-rebuttal — the most important trust signal
- 1Readers may see this as a one-book utility rather than an ongoing subscription, leading to fast churn after finishing or abandoning one title.
- 2Spoiler-safe accuracy is hard; one bad reveal could destroy trust and prevent word-of-mouth growth.
- 3General-purpose AI tools may offer good-enough answers for free, making a specialized product harder to monetize.
Evidence Summary
How AI synthesized this insight — no verbatim quotes
Several commenters described failing multiple times to get through long classics because they could not track characters or survive the opening chapters. A few detailed active workarounds such as note-taking, external reference pages, audiobooks, and adaptations. That pattern shows a practical reading-friction problem rather than pure literary preference. The strongest opportunity is not teaching literature, but reducing cognitive overhead so readers can finish books they already want to read.
